> Restore collection should treat maxShardsPerNode=-1 as unlimited like create
> collection

> Today we can never restore the cloud example gettingstarted collection
> because it sets maxShardsPerNode=-1 . We have special handling for -1 in
> CreateCollectionCmd but not in RestoreCmd.
> Today RestoreCmd does has this check and it fails to restore the collection
> {code}
> if ((numShards * totalReplicasPerShard) > (availableNodeCount *
> maxShardsPerNode)) {
> throw new SolrException(ErrorCode.BAD_REQUEST,
> String.format(Locale.ROOT, "Solr cloud with available number of
> nodes:%d is insufficient for"
> + " restoring a collection with %d shards, total replicas per
> shard %d and maxShardsPerNode %d."
> + " Consider increasing maxShardsPerNode value OR number of
> available nodes.",
> availableNodeCount, numShards, totalReplicasPerShard,
> maxShardsPerNode));
> }
> {code}
> Steps to reproduce:
> Steps to reproduce:
> 1. ./bin/solr start -e cloud -noprompt : This creates a 2 node cluster and a
> gettingstarted collection which 2X2
> 2. Added 4 docs (id=1,2,3,4) with commit=true and openSearcher=true (default)
> 3. Call backup:
> http://localhost:8983/solr/admin/collections?action=BACKUP&name=gettingstarted_backup&collection=gettingstarted&location=/Users/varunthacker/solr-7.1.0
> 4. Call restore:
> http://localhost:8983/solr/admin/collections?action=restore&name=gettingstarted_backup&collection=restore_gettingstarted&location=/Users/varunthacker/solr-7.1.0
